In order to achieve the above object, the utility model provides a following technical scheme: the livestock feed preparation device comprises a drying bin, the right side of the drying bin is fixedly connected with a fixing plate, the top of the fixed plate is fixedly connected with a speed reducing motor, the output end of the speed reducing motor penetrates through the drying bin and is fixedly connected with a rotating rod, one side of the rotating rod, which is far away from the speed reducing motor, is movably connected with a bearing, one side of the bearing, which is far away from the rotating rod, is fixedly connected with the connecting part of the drying bin, the top and the bottom of the rotating rod are both fixedly connected with stirring plates, the bottom of the inner cavity of the drying bin is fixedly connected with a heating bin, the inner cavity of the heating bin is fixedly connected with a heating rod, the right side of the top of the drying bin is fixedly connected with an air heater, the left side of the air heater is communicated with a transverse pipe, the bottom of the transverse pipe is communicated with a vertical pipe, the bottom of the vertical pipe is communicated with the joint of the drying bin, and the inner cavity of the vertical pipe is fixedly connected with a separation net.
Preferably, the bottom of the left side of the drying bin is movably connected with an opening plate through a hinge, and the surface of the opening plate is movably connected with the contact surface of the drying bin through a lock pin lock catch.
Preferably, the top of the left side of the drying bin is communicated with a feeding pipe, and the top of the feeding pipe is communicated with a feeding hopper.
Preferably, an air outlet is formed in the top of the right side of the inner cavity of the drying bin, and a protective net is fixedly connected to the inner cavity of the air outlet.
Preferably, the two sides of the bottom of the drying bin are fixedly connected with supporting legs, the bottom of each supporting leg is fixedly connected with a supporting plate, and the bottom of each supporting plate is fixedly connected with an anti-slip pad.

When in use, silage is fed into an inner cavity of a drying bin 1 by a user along a feeding hopper 6, the inner cavity of the drying bin 1 is heated by starting a heating rod 17 in an inner cavity of a heating bin 16 to dry the fodder, a rotating rod 15 is driven to rotate by starting a speed reduction motor 11, a stirring plate 13 is driven to rotate by rotating the rotating rod 15 to stir the fodder so that the fodder is uniformly heated, hot air generated by starting an air heater 9 enters an inner cavity of a vertical pipe 8 along a transverse pipe 7 and then enters an inner cavity of the drying bin 1 to dry the fodder at the top, hot air carries water vapor to be discharged along an air outlet 10, the opening plate 3 is opened by the user after the fodder is dried to discharge the fodder to finish a batch of drying operation, the device can achieve the function of quick drying by matching use of the above structures, and the problem that the existing livestock silage production device on the market does not have the function of quick drying is solved, the feed has more water content, is not beneficial to long-time storage of the feed, is not beneficial to feeding animals when the green yellow is not inoculated, has influence on the problem of eating of the animals in winter, and is suitable for popularization and use.
